Shirataka Town in Yamagata Prefecture, praised as the "Arcadia of the East," is a place where beautiful nature remains untouched. In 2021, historic storehouses and residences, watched over by the Iide Mountain Range, were fully renovated into "Dozo Suites" accommodations. Surrounded by a vast garden, all four storehouses have been transformed into private luxury spaces as "one-building rental suites with cypress baths." Enjoy an extraordinary stay in these charming rooms while admiring rare trees and natural beauty in the garden, experiencing the tranquil and serene flow of time in this peaceful countryside.For dining, a young chef skilled in French cuisine crafts dishes that highlight local ingredients while embracing regional culture and traditions. Dinner features a course menu showcasing "local gourmet delights," paired with exquisite Japanese sake or wine for an elevated experience. Breakfast includes traditional fermented foods such as miso soup, natto, and pickles—an ideal way to rejuvenate your body at the start of the day.Savor seasonal culinary treasures rooted in local traditions while reflecting on the charm of these historic storehouses. This Hotel is located on the site of the former Shirakawa Elementary School in Kyoto, which closed in 2011 and has over 100 years of academic history since its establishment as an elementary school. Surrounded by cultural landmarks such as Heian Shrine, ROHM Theatre Kyoto, and The National Museum of Modern Art, Kyoto, this location offers a unique blend of vibrant tourist attractions and the authentic daily life of Kyoto residents. Our goal is to create a Hotel where guests can experience the traditions and culture of Kyoto beyond just staying overnight.The interior design is crafted by Nomura Co., Ltd., combining the elegance of Japanese aesthetics with modern functionality. From guest rooms that balance traditional beauty with contemporary comfort to a courtyard and cultural activities deeply rooted in Kyoto's heritage, we provide an environment where every moment becomes part of your journey at this one-of-a-kind Hotel.

Stay amid décor that harmonizes with nature and experience Kyoto’s living sense of beauty.In Kyoto’s Okazaki district—where culture and tranquility are part of everyday life—Hotel Okura Kyoto Okazaki Bettei offers a stay that lets you encounter Kyoto aesthetics alive in the present, embraced by calm and open space.Okazaki is a cultural area dotted with temples and shrines such as Ginkaku-ji, Nanzen-ji, and Heian Shrine, as well as the National Museum of Modern Art, Kyoto.The refined sensibilities passed down through generations still quietly live on in daily life here.Listen to the gentle sound of water along the Lake Biwa Canal and the Philosopher’s Path, and enjoy moments of clarity within the stillness that fills nearby temples. Each visit reveals a new expression of seasonal beauty in the garden.Located next to Shinshu Otani-ha Okazaki Betsuin (Higashi Honganji Okazaki Betsuin), said to be on the site of Saint Shinran’s former hermitage, this setting lets you feel close to its historic main hall and the lush nature of its grounds.Of 60 rooms in total, 8 are suites with balconies—offering relaxing moments alongside scenery unique to Okazaki.Throughout the Hotel, works by “GO ON,” a project unit formed by six successors carrying on Kyoto’s traditional crafts, are featured throughout—inviting you to sense Kyoto aesthetics alive today where heritage and innovation intersect.On the first floor restaurant, enjoy innovative French cuisine inspired by Kyoto’s seasons while overlooking the garden.

The full-service hotel "The Westin Yokohama" opened on June 13, 2022, featuring guest rooms of over 42 square meters, four attractive restaurants and bars, and a variety of wellness programs. All guest rooms are equipped with the signature Westin "Heavenly Bed," and the wellness floor includes a spa, indoor pool, and fitness facilities. Enjoy your time at the top-floor "Code Bar" on the 23rd floor or indulge in afternoon tea at the "Lobby Lounge," along with three other exceptional dining options.

A 3-minute walk from Yubatake, this Hotel is located in the heart of the newly established "Ura-Kusatsu," a new landmark. The concept of the Hotel is "1/f Fluctuation." "1/f Fluctuation" refers to the harmony between regularity and irregularity. Like the rhythm of a human heartbeat, this non-constant rhythm, found in various natural elements of the world, brings a sense of comfort to the human mind. The flickering flames of a bonfire or hearth, the flowing motion of water, the rustling sound of trees, and the swaying lanterns as you stroll through the twilight of Ura-Kusatsu. WEAZER Nishi-Izu is an intimate two-room retreat that blends off-grid architecture powered by 100% renewable energy with the privacy of an exclusive whole-villa stay. Designed to generate its own electricity and water, the architecture is more than environmental technology—it is a philosophy for living in harmony with the nature of this land. Panoramic views over Suruga Bay, the sound of waves and birdsong, and ever-changing skies and sea come together to create a special time that frees your mind from everyday life.For dinner, enjoy creative Italian cuisine showcasing the blessings of Izu at our sister property, LOQUAT Nishi-Izu, selected for the Michelin Guide Hotel Selection 2025 “Selected.” With attentive service from your dedicated concierge, savor a one-of-a-kind stay where nature, architecture, and cuisine exist in perfect harmony.
